Grijalva, McClung set to debate Oct. 13

U.S. Rep. Raúl Grijalva has agreed to debate Republican challenger Ruth McClung, after her camp hand-delivered a request for a face-off before the Nov. 2 election.

Grijalva's campaign responded Friday asking that a third-party, nonpartisan organization sponsor and run the debate. He also asked that all candidates for the District 7 House seat be invited.

By the midafternoon, the terms had been agreed upon. The Tucson Hispanic Chamber of Commerce will host the Oct. 13 debate at Pima Community College's Desert Vista Campus, 5901 S. Calle Santa Cruz, beginning at 5 p.m.

The announcement comes on the heels of a McClung-sponsored poll showing she was behind by just seven points. The poll of 450 voters tallied 42 percent Grijalva, 35 percent McClung, with 23 percent of voters undecided.

It was done by American Political Consultants, which bills itself as supporting "Pro-Life and Pro-Family candidates for public office."
